Karachi: At the beginning of business today (Thursday), an increase in the value of dollar is being seen in the interbank market.
According to details, the value of dollar rose by Rs0.45 to settle at Rs284.25.
During yesterday's (Wednesday) business, the price of dollar continued to fluctuate in the interbank market and at the end of business, the dollar increased by Rs0.76 to close at Rs283.80.
On the other hand, the dollar remained at Rs290 in the open market yesterday.
